For the 2025 school year, there are 7 private elementary schools serving 1,582 students in Media, PA.
The top ranked private elementary schools in Media, PA include Benchmark School, Davidson School, and Davidson School Elwyn Inc.
The average acceptance rate is 92%, which is higher than the Pennsylvania private elementary school average acceptance rate of 87%.
